Justice and Oologah are places in Oklahoma.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Oologah has the higher population (1,766 vs 1,601 in Justice). Justice has the higher median household income ($93,580 vs $83,977 in Oologah). Justice has the higher median home value ($214,900 vs $186,100 in Oologah).
